If you moved from Indonesia to Dominican Republic, you would find that Dominican Republic is 69.0% more expensive than Indonesia overall. A IDR1,345,683,750 salary in Indonesia would need to be roughly DOP5,659,771 in Dominican Republic to maintain the same lifestyle, and you’d need to navigate life in Spanish. You’ll also switch from driving on the left to the right.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it cheaper to live in Dominican Republic than Indonesia?

No — Dominican Republic is on average about 29% more expensive than Indonesia. City-level variation matters.

How much money do I need to move to Dominican Republic?

Plan for at least 3 months of living expenses — roughly DOP1,414,943 in Dominican Republic on a IDR1,345,683,750 comparable salary — plus one-off moving costs (flights, shipping, a rental deposit, and visa fees).

Can I work remotely from Dominican Republic?

Internet is rarely the blocker — Dominican Republic has 10.7 fixed broadband subscriptions per 100 people. The real questions are legal: digital nomad visa eligibility, your employer's overseas-work policy, and tax residency in both countries.

Is Dominican Republic safe for expats?

Indonesia performs better than Dominican Republic across all safety metrics. The homicide rate in Dominican Republic is 12.4 per 100,000 people, compared to 0.6 in Indonesia. About 40% of people in Dominican Republic feel safe walking alone at night.

How is healthcare in Dominican Republic compared to Indonesia?

Indonesia generally does better on health & wellbeing, though Dominican Republic leads in doctors per 10,000 people. There are 22.3 doctors per 10,000 people in Dominican Republic, compared to 6.9 in Indonesia. Dominican Republic scores 77 on the WHO universal health coverage index (Indonesia: 55).

What's the weather like in Dominican Republic compared to Indonesia?

The average high temperature in Santo Domingo is 87°F, compared to 89°F in Jakarta. Santo Domingo receives around 57.0 in of rainfall per year, while Jakarta gets 65.2 in.

What language do they speak in Dominican Republic?

The official language in Dominican Republic is Spanish. In Indonesia, the official language is Indonesian.
